Tertiary education to witness huge boost in 2nd tenure – Kwara Commissioner
The Kwara Commissioner for Tertiary Education, Dr Alabi Abolore, has assured stakeholders in the tertiary education sector of an enhanced progression in terms of qualitative service delivery in the second tenure of Gov. A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q.
The commissioner gave the assurance while receiving the new Permanent Secretary, Hajia Habiba Saidu, posted to the ministry on her assumption of duty on Monday in Ilorin.
Abolore said that the re-election of AbdulRazaq in the just concluded election would rebirth productive and structural enhancements in all tertiary institutions across the state.
Mrs Saidu also collaborated the commissioner's assurances of a huge boost for the tertiary education sector in the second term of AbdulRazaq.
She admonished staff of the ministry to be steadfast, committed and focused in the discharge of their responsibilities.
Mrs Saidu stated that the garment factory, which is nearing completion, is one among the giant strides of AbdulRazaq.
She said this was no doubt, a clear testimony that the working governor truly deserved his re-election, considering the numerous achievements recorded in all sectors during his first tenure.
The permanent secretary appreciated the reception accorded her on assumption of office and solicited for harmonious working relationship with the management and staff of the ministry.
